Reach for this book when your child is grappling with the concept of fairness or feeling pressured to follow the crowd against their better judgment. It serves as a powerful bridge for families looking to instill a sense of moral courage through the lens of Islamic history and the profound legacy of the Ahl al-Bayt. By exploring the life of Husayn ibn Ali, children are introduced to a hero whose strength came from his principles rather than his physical might. This biography balances the weight of historical sacrifice with the inspiring light of Husayn's character. While it touches on the gravity of his stand for justice, the narrative focuses on the themes of integrity, bravery, and the importance of standing up for others. It is an ideal choice for middle-grade readers who are beginning to navigate their own cultural identity and seek role models who embody unwavering resilience in the face of adversity.
